Tobacco Overview
  • 60 species of tobacco; primarily Nicotiana tabacum used in the US.

  • Nicotine identified as the main active ingredient.

1. History and Origin Source
  • Introduced to the West in late 15th century via Columbus and Native Americans.

  • Increased popularity in Europe; by mid-1600s, widespread use across central Europe.

  • Medical use declined after nicotine's toxic properties were understood (1828).

2. Production Uses and Administration
  • Consumed as cigarettes, cigars, snuff, chewing tobacco, and pipe tobacco.

  • Administered through various routes, primarily inhalation (smoking), oral (chewing tobacco), or nasal (snuff).

  • Absorption of nicotine is rapid, especially from the lungs.

3. Lack of Health Benefits
  • No known health benefits; associated with significant and wide-ranging health risks.

4. Pharmacology of Nicotine (Mechanism of Action)
  • Sites of Action: Acts as a cholinergic agonist on acetylcholine receptors in the central and peripheral nervous systems.

  • Physiological Effects: Increases dopamine release (contributing to its addictive properties), elevates blood pressure and heart rate, and causes the release of adrenaline.

5. Pharmacokinetics
  • Absorption: Rapid from lungs (approximately 7 seconds to reach the brain) when smoked; absorbed more slowly through mucous membranes (e.g., mouth, nose).

  • Metabolism: Primarily in the liver by the enzyme cytochrome P450 2A6 (CYP2A6).

  • Elimination: Nicotine and its metabolites (primarily cotinine) are eliminated in urine.

6. Acute Effects of Nicotine
  • Nicotine has biphasic effects, meaning it can act as both a stimulant and a depressant depending on the dose and individual.

  • Stimulant properties are generally weaker compared to other amphetamines, but it can enhance alertness, concentration, and memory at lower doses.

7. Effects of Chronic Tobacco Use
  • Linked to serious diseases including lung cancer, heart disease, stroke, chronic obstructive pulmonary disease (COPD), emphysema, and other respiratory issues.

  • CDC estimates approximately 480,000 deaths annually in the US due to smoking-related causes, making it a leading cause of preventable death.

8. Tolerance and Dependence
  • Quick development of nicotine tolerance, leading to a need for increased doses to achieve desired effects.

  • Leads to strong physical and psychological dependence.

  • Withdrawal symptoms: Include intense cravings, irritability, anxiety, difficulty concentrating, depressed mood, increased appetite, and sleep disturbances.

9. Trends and Prevalence of Tobacco Use
  • 2015 Smoking Statistics: (Note: These statistics represent the prevalence in 2015 and may have changed since then).

    • Males aged 12-17: 4.6%

    • Males aged 18-25: 30.7%

    • Males aged 26+: 22.5%

    • Females aged 12-17: 3.8%

    • Females aged 18-25: 22.7%

    • Females aged 26+: 17.7%

  • Initiation Trends: The majority of smokers start in adolescence; 90% of smoking-related deaths in adults began smoking as teens.

  • E-Cigarette Use (2011-2015): Showed a notable increase among teens during this period, affecting overall tobacco product use trends.

10. Variables Impacting Use and Initiation
  • Influences on Initiation: Complex interaction of biological predispositions, psychological factors (e.g., stress, mood), and environmental factors (e.g., peer pressure, parental smoking, media influence, accessibility).

  • Socioeconomic Factors: Lower educational attainment and unemployment are generally linked to a higher prevalence of smoking.

11. Passive Smoking
  • Recognized as a serious health risk, also known as secondhand smoke, containing numerous known carcinogens.

  • Significant health impacts on non-smokers, including increased risks of heart disease, lung cancer, respiratory infections, and sudden infant death syndrome (SIDS).

12. Treatment and Cessation Strategies
  • Motivation for Quitting: Can be intrinsically motivated (e.g., health concerns, desire for self-improvement) or extrinsically motivated (e.g., social pressures, financial cost, family influence).

  • Strategies for Quitting: Include behavioral programs (e.g., counseling, support groups) and pharmacological interventions.

  • Success rates for quitting are significantly higher with formal treatment and support.

13. Nicotine Replacement Therapies (NRTs)
  • Designed to deliver nicotine without the harmful chemicals found in tobacco smoke, increasing quit rates.

  • Types include nicotine gum, patches, lozenges, nasal sprays, and inhalers.

  • Additional pharmacological options for cessation include non-nicotine medications like Bupropion (an antidepressant) and Varenicline (a partial nicotinic receptor agonist).
